OR09: Purdue's investigation on Research Data Repositories

OR09 day 1, session 2a: Michael Witt (Purdue University) "Eliciting Faculty Requirements for Research Data Repositories

Preliminary results of investigation in what researchers want regarding data (repositories). Some good stuff. Hope the slides will be published soon - or the report for that matter.

See Seans weblog for the ten primary questions, good for self-evalution also. Mark Leggott then quickly added an additional 11th question to his slideshow - how much is in your wallet...

Method: interviews and followup survey with twenty scientists, transcribed (using Nvivo). “It was like drinking from a firehose.” For each, a “data curation profile” was created, with example data & description. Will beinteresting when it comes out.
